About ASNs
An ASN (Autonomous System Number) identifies a single network — a collection of IP address ranges operated under one administrative authority, such as a cloud provider, CDN, hosting company, or ISP. Every ASN is a globally unique number (like AS13335 for Cloudflare or AS16509 for Amazon AWS).
Networks announce the IP ranges they own to the rest of the internet using BGP (Border Gateway Protocol). Those announcements are what let routers worldwide agree on a path to any address — so the ASN is effectively the answer to “whose network does this IP live on, and how do packets get there?” One operator often controls several ASNs, which is why we roll sibling networks together.
Because of that, the ASN is where DNS meets the physical internet:
- A domain’s A / AAAA records resolve to IP addresses, and every IP belongs to exactly one ASN — so the ASN reveals who actually serves a site, even when the DNS records don’t name the provider.
- It separates the network (e.g. Fastly) from the platform running on top of it (e.g. GitHub Pages), which a domain’s records alone can obscure.
- When a site’s IPs move from one ASN to another, that’s a real hosting or CDN change — the signal behind the joins and exits tracked on this page.
